Ezekiel 30:2-4
New English Translation
2 “Son of man, prophesy and say, ‘This is what the Sovereign Lord says:
“‘Wail, “Alas, the day is here!”[a]
3 For the day is near,
the day of the Lord is near;
it will be a day of storm clouds,[b]
it will be a time of judgment[c] for the nations.
4 A sword will come against Egypt
and panic will overtake Ethiopia
when the slain fall in Egypt
and they carry away her wealth
and dismantle her foundations.
Footnotes
- Ezekiel 30:2 tn Heb “Alas for the day.”
- Ezekiel 30:3 tn Heb “a day of clouds.” The expression occurs also in Joel 2:2 and Zeph 1:15; it recalls the appearance of God at Mount Sinai (Exod 19:9, 16, 18).
- Ezekiel 30:3 tn Heb “a time.” The words “of judgment” have been added in the translation for clarification (see the following verses).
Ezekiel 30:2-4
New International Version
2 “Son of man, prophesy and say: ‘This is what the Sovereign Lord says:
“‘Wail(A) and say,
“Alas for that day!”
3 For the day is near,(B)
the day of the Lord(C) is near—
a day of clouds,
a time of doom for the nations.
4 A sword will come against Egypt,(D)
and anguish will come upon Cush.[a](E)
When the slain fall in Egypt,
her wealth will be carried away
and her foundations torn down.(F)
Footnotes
- Ezekiel 30:4 That is, the upper Nile region; also in verses 5 and 9
